On September 1, 2016, CloudFlare reported a complete shutdown of internet access to its sites from Gabon. As of September 5, internet connectivity in Gabon was partially restored with some news reports suggesting that access to social media sites remained restricted. The situation is being monitored for any changes and updates will be provided accordingly. On September 6, an overnight "curfew" was observed where the internet was disabled and re-enabled the following morning. This pattern repeated on September 7 as well.
